As of Friday, December 2, the doors of the Palacio de Bellas tunnel were opened to receive the Great Warehouse Sale of the National Institute of Fine Arts and Literature and offer discounts on music, dance, theater, literature, visual arts or architecture books, among other specialties.
The auction open to the public until Sunday December 11 contemplates the sale 7 thousand 500 books of more than 400 titleswith attractive discounts of up to 50 percent on the regular price.
